Decision matrix

What should the AI answer?

The safest rollout starts narrow, then expands after review.

QuestionWhat to checkBest next step
Are calls repetitive?Same questions, same intake fields, same service areasStart with scripted intake
Are emergencies possible?Safety, health, gas, electrical, legal, or high-risk callsAdd immediate human escalation
Do calls become quotes?Photos, locations, measurements, timing, and customer detailsSummarize for estimator review
Do you need booking?Calendar rules, service windows, staff capacityAdd booking only after intake works

The AI should disclose its role, collect only useful information, and leave sensitive decisions to staff.

Questions

Before you book

Can an AI receptionist replace my front desk?

For most Alberta businesses, the better first use is overflow, after-hours intake, routing, and summaries. Staff should still handle sensitive judgment calls.

Can it book appointments?

Yes, but booking should usually come after the intake script, escalation rules, and CRM summary are working reliably.

Is it safe for customer calls?

It can be safer when it is transparent, narrow, logged, reviewed, and designed with human escalation for urgent or sensitive calls.
